HeiTech Padu bags RM37mil contract from MoH


PETALING JAYA: Heitech Padu Bhd has secured a contract worth RM37.02mil from the Health Ministry (MoH).

In a filing with Bursa Malaysia, HeiTech said the contract was to supply, deliver, install, build, configure, integrate, migrate, test and commission the use of HIS@KKM hardware, software and systems at Sultan Ismail Hospital, Johor.

The contract is for a period of 36 months commencing from Dec 18, 2023 to Dec 17, 2026.

HeiTech Padu expects the contract to contribute positively to the earnings and net assets per share of the company for the financial year ending Dec 31, 2023 and onwards until the completion of the contract.

In the recent third quarter ended Sept 30, 2023, HeiTech Padu recorded a net loss of RM1.4mil on a revenue of RM63.4mil.
